Stryker closes acquisition of Cerus Endovascular
Summary
Cerus Endovascular is involved in the design, development, manufacture and supply of interventional neurovascular devices and delivery systems used by neuroradiologists for the treatment of intracranial aneurysms. The company’s offerings include the Contour Neurovascular System and the Neqstent Coil Assisted Flow Diverter. The addition of Cerus Endovascular’s portfolio is expected to accommodate the increasing demand for one-and-done intrasaccular aneurysm therapy. Global law firm Dechert was appointed by Cerus Endovascular to advise on the deal with Stryker.
